I had a group of BFPBs on the TTGP board, and it was great. We were able to share things/ask questions/vent about the TTC process when we didn't feel comfortable posting publicly. They were the first people (besides my husband) that I contacted when I got my BFP, and I consider them among my dearest friends.
I agree with Drea that it is good for labor buddies to be people who don't have EDDs too close together so that there's less of a chance of you going into labor at the same time.
I'm labor buddied up with Maniac McGee, whose EDD is 3 weeks after mine.
We've exchanged email addresses as well as cell #s (I've actually known her a while from the TTGP board, so I feel comfortable sharing this info already) and so when it comes time for one of us to head to L&D, the idea is we would text the other person, and they will start a thread to keep you all updated. If any other big baby-related 'happenings' were to occur that were keeping one of us away from a computer, the other would let you know about that as well. I expect we'll get to know each other even better over the next several months.
Having been through the BFPB thing, my advice is to choose someone from the board who you feel like you have something in common with, who you feel like you gel with, and who you trust to share personal info with, even if it is just an email address.
